Velocys establishes strategic alliance with TRI for gasification systems for BTL plants

Green Car Congress

Velocys plc, the developer of smaller scale gas-to-liquids (GTL), signed a memorandum of understanding (MoU) with ThermoChem Recovery International, Inc. The partners have already started a joint development of the engineering design for a 1,400 barrel per day BTL plant to produce renewable diesel and jet fuels from woody biomass.

Volkswagen AG provides details on investigations into NOx cheating; origin and fixes; new strategic direction

Green Car Congress

Approximately 450 internal and external experts are involved in the investigations, which are being conducted in two phases.
